Biden's move on Yemen sparks new questions

The Pentagon has said it halted intelligence sharing related to offensive operations, but that it is also reviewing how best to implement the new policy. The Biden administration has also pointed to its suspension of two precision-guided bomb sales to Saudi Arabia approved late in the Trump administration. But the administration has also made clear it will continue defending Saudi Arabia from attacks, including after one this past week at an airport near the kingdom’s border with Yemen that singed a civilian plane.
